Man Utd Financial Results Show Profit Increase After Job Cuts

Wadh KassimFebruary 25, 2026

Mancherster United generated an operating profit of £32.6 million ($44 million) in the first six months of the fiscal year, compared with a £3.9 million loss for the same period last year.

Tanzania Sounds Alarm Over Severe Flu, COVID‑19, Dengue, and Cholera Outbreaks

Wadh KassimFebruary 25, 2026February 25, 2026

The Ministry urged citizens to take preventive measures such as covering the mouth and nose when coughing or sneezing, frequent handwashing with soap and running water or using sanitizers, avoiding unnecessary crowding, and wearing masks when symptomatic or in crowded areas.

South Korea Birth Rate Jumps But Still Under Key Fertility Threshold

Wadh KassimFebruary 25, 2026

Yearly births rose more than six percent between 2024 and 2025, South Korea’s Ministry of Data and Statistics said, the sharpest year-on-year rise since 2010.

Somaliland Pins Hopes on Critical Mineral Gold Rush

Wadh KassimFebruary 25, 2026

Officials in the breakaway territory of northern Somalia say there is an abundance of critical minerals in its ground, and potentially billions of barrels of oil, and they hope that Israel’s move to recognise Somaliland’s independence in December could unlock an influx of investment.
